Markets in and near Audrix
- Le Buisson-de-Cadouin: market Friday (5km)
- Le Bugue: market Tuesday (5km)
- Saint-Cyprien: market Sunday (8km)
- Les Eyzies: market Monday all day - seasonal market only (8km)
- Belves: market Saturday (13km)
- Lalinde: market Thursday (18km)
- Sarlat: market Wednesday & Saturday all day (21km)
- Monpazier: market Thursday (23km)
- Domme: market Thursday (23km)
- Vergt: market Friday (24km)

Geography and distances
Audrix is in the south-west of France at 38 kilometres from Perigueux, the department capital (general information: Audrix is 455 kilometres from Paris).
Distance to Audrix
from Perigueux (prefecture): 38 km
from Paris: 455 km
from Calais: 678 km
from Nice: 520 km
from Bordeaux: 120 km
from Strasbourg: 662 km
Getting here
Most visitors fly into the airports at either Bergerac (or Bordeaux). Alternatively to drive from the cross-channel ports takes around 9-11 hours. For driving distances to Audrix from anywhere in France see driving distances and route planner.
